How high should the mantel be over an electric fireplace mantel only fireplace?
The ideal mantel height will increase the appeal of the fireplace and make it a central feature of the room. However, the best height can vary from room to. The average height for a mantel is 12 inches higher than the fireplace's opening, however this can vary based on the ceiling's height and the design of the mantel. The thickness of the mantel could also affect its height of mounting. Mantels with a higher thickness can carry more weight, and so they can be mounted higher than thinner mantels.
When choosing a mounting height it is crucial to consider the type of decorative objects you intend to display. Picture frames and vases can be hung on the mantel without risking damage. Larger items like mirrors and framed artwork may need to be more securely anchored to prevent them from being dislodged with time. It is also essential to make sure that the mantel and the mounting method are rated for the weight of the item you intend to display.

The installation of a mantel is a process that requires precise tools, adherence to safety protocols, and a careful step-by-step process. You will require a level: to ensure that the mantel is horizontal. You will also require a stud locater to mark the stud locations. It is also an excellent idea to use a drill equipped with bits to make pilot holes. You should also wear safety glasses to protect your eyes from dust and dirt.
A mantel shelf should not be combustible. The mantel ledge must be able to stand up to the heat of the fireplace and therefore should be constructed from materials that are able to endure high temperatures and fire. Also, make sure that the ledge does not touching the firebox or other areas of the fireplace which could be hot.

Mantels can be the focal point of a room, drawing the eye and setting the mood. It can be used to showcase artwork or to provide a space to personalize. This can be achieved by following a few easy design principles and utilizing an array of decorative objects.
Choose a neutral hue as the background for your mantel display. This gives a crisp, clean appearance that will complement your artwork and accessories. Then, choose a shade that adds depth and contrast to the overall design scheme. For example a dark blue shade can be a great match for the white mantel and provide subtle accents to the overall color palette.
Avoid cluttering up your mantel. A lot of items can overshadow the focal point and cause it to lose its awe-inspiring appeal. To make your vignette more balanced, select odd-sized pieces and vary their dimensions. A large vase and two smaller ones can be placed in a pleasing grouping on the mantel. This arrangement also emphasizes the height of the fire place.
Layering is a different method to enhance a mantel's appearance. Place larger decorative items, like art or mirrors, on the wall to create a backdrop and then place smaller items, like candles or ornaments in front. The layered look gives your mantel a more lively, textured look.
Lighting is an essential element of a mantel design that is successful. Make use of ambient lighting, such as wall sconces or recessed lighting, to illuminate the area. This creates an inviting and warm atmosphere for your guests. In addition, you can use spotlighting to highlight certain features of your vignette or to bring attention to a specific thing.
